Same here. I haven't ordered the X6 yet, but I have been on the fence for months vs the new Cayenne. I currently own a 997 S cab and this is my 5th Porsche. I owned a Cayenne S when they first came out and I loved it, but like TheX5, feel you don't get your money's worth in options. The new Hybrid Cayenne is just that...new and not proven and I would stay away from it until the at least the first model year. Look at how many X6 hybrids are sitting on dealers lots!
TheX5 and I have had many conversations on another forum about the getting the Cayenne and an X5/X6. I am still on the fence. Porsche's are solidly built and if you plan on keeping it, you could really get up well over 100,000 miles with regular maintenance and not have too many worries. Given my BMW experiences, I can not say the same.
But, I love the looks of the X6. it's very unique and I love the stance. The Cayenne is softened from the old model and there are so many look alikes out there, even a car lover like me has to do a double take on what it is!
If you do deal on one, the going rate on the lot is about 6-7% off MSRP. But, that can change since Porsche's allotment to dealer is cut way back, so the dealings could get less off MSRP.
